> Problem: when running the RemoteAgent (the process in which the user's
> code is being run), a problem occurs if the -classpath or
> -Xbootclasspath/p: argument contains a space, as the spaces are not
> properly quoted.
>
> We currently construct a "connection spec" string in ExecutionControl,
> and then parse it in JDIConnection to construct connector arguments.
> So we would need to keep some kind of quoting through this process.
> This seems a little bit unnecessary - why not pass the arguments as a
> map (with proper quoting of the values in the map), avoiding the parsing?
